Marla Mallett (New Westminster, BC) needed a tiebreaker to advance to the playoffs, Mallett finished 3-2 in the 24-team qualifying round. . In their opening game, Mallett lost 3-2 to Kelly Scott (Kelowna, BC), then responded with a 9-1 win over Karla Thompson (Kamloops, BC). Mallett went on to lose 7-5 against Morgan Muise (Calgary, AB). Mallett responded with a 6-4 win over Alyssa Kyllo (Vernon, BC). Mallett won 6-5 against Lisa Eyamie (Calgary, AB) in their final qualifying round match.
Mallett earned 1.250 world rankings points for their preliminary round wins, moving up 29 spots the World Ranking Standings into 124th place overall with 3.452 total points. Mallett ranks 59th overall on the Year-to-Date rankings with 1.250 points earned so far this season.
